king
2022-05-17 2ae980243b7ad705dea575eadcfc4cf4e24073bd
src/menu/components/form/tab-form/index.jsx
@@ -467,35 +467,30 @@
        index = i
      }
      let label = item.label || ''
      if (item.field && item.field.toLowerCase() !== label.toLowerCase()) {
        label = label + ' (' + item.field + ')'
      }
      if (['text', 'number', 'textarea', 'color'].includes(item.type) && _item.field !== item.field) {
        _inputfields.push({
          field: item.field,
          label: _inputIndex + '、' + item.label
          label: _inputIndex + '、' + label
        })
        _inputIndex++
      }
      if (appType === 'mob') {
        if (_form.field !== item.field && item.hidden !== 'true' && ['text', 'number'].includes(item.type)) {
          _tabfields.push({
            field: item.field,
            label: _tabIndex + '、' + item.label
          })
          _tabIndex++
        }
      } else {
        if (_form.field !== item.field && item.hidden !== 'true' && ['text', 'number', 'select', 'link'].includes(item.type)) {
          _tabfields.push({
            field: item.field,
            label: _tabIndex + '、' + item.label
          })
          _tabIndex++
        }
      if (_form.field !== item.field && item.hidden !== 'true' && ['text', 'number', 'select', 'link'].includes(item.type)) {
        _tabfields.push({
          field: item.field,
          label: _tabIndex + '、' + label
        })
        _tabIndex++
      }
      if (item.type === 'switch') {
        _linksupFields.push({
          field: item.field,
          label: _linkIndex + '、' + item.label
          label: _linkIndex + '、' + label
        })
      }
      
@@ -510,7 +505,7 @@
        })
        _linksupFields.push({
          value: item.field,
          text: _linkIndex + '、' + item.label
          text: _linkIndex + '、' + label
        })
        _linkIndex++
@@ -743,6 +738,7 @@
          />}
          <FormAction config={card} group={group} updateconfig={this.updateGroup}/>
        </div> : null}
        <div className="component-name"><div className="center">{card.name}</div></div>
        <Modal
          title={this.state.dict['model.edit']}
          visible={this.state.visible}